Nurse Informatics In The information

How does a Nurse Informatics professional typically collaborate with clinical staff to improve patient care processes?

Nurse Informatics professionals work closely with nurses, physicians, and other healthcare staff to identify opportunities for improving clinical workflows and patient care through technology. They often serve as a bridge between IT and clinical teams, translating clinical needs into technical solutions and ensuring that electronic health records (EHR) and other systems are user-friendly and effective. Regular collaboration includes participating in meetings, conducting training sessions, and gathering feedback from end-users to optimize system performance. This ongoing partnership helps ensure that technology enhances rather than hinders patient care.

Are nurse informatics in high demand?

Nurse informatics is a growing field due to increasing reliance on healthcare technology and electronic health records. The demand for nurse informaticists is expected to rise as healthcare organizations seek professionals skilled in data management, clinical systems, and health IT to improve patient care and operational efficiency.

What can I do with a nursing informatics degree?

A nursing informatics degree prepares professionals to manage healthcare data, optimize clinical workflows, and implement health information systems. Graduates often work as clinical informaticists, health IT specialists, or data analysts in hospitals, clinics, or healthcare organizations, utilizing skills in electronic health records (EHR) systems and health data management.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Nurse Informatics,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Nurse Informatics professional, you need a solid background in nursing practice combined with expertise in information technology, typically supported by a BSN degree and additional informatics certification such as ANCC Informatics Nursing Certification. Familiarity with electronic health records (EHR) systems, data analytics tools, and healthcare information systems is essential. Strong analytical thinking, effective communication, and the ability to lead interdisciplinary teams are valuable soft skills in this role. These competencies are crucial for optimizing patient care through technology, improving workflow efficiencies, and ensuring accurate data management in healthcare settings.

What are Nurse Informatics In The healthcare industry?

Nurse Informatics professionals are registered nurses who specialize in integrating nursing science with information technology to improve patient care. They analyze and manage healthcare data, implement electronic health records (EHRs), and work with clinical teams to streamline processes and enhance outcomes. Their role bridges the gap between clinical practice and IT, ensuring that technology solutions meet the needs of patients and healthcare providers. Nurse Informaticists also play a key role in training staff and maintaining data privacy and security.

Job description

Employment Type:Full timeShift:Day ShiftDescription:High level of understanding accounting practices and how data tables can be connected to create analysis on business operations, from time to perform a task to Open accounts payable. Strong skills in creating filters, charts through multiple tools, Power BI, Tableau, etc.

Position is hybrid, three days a week in the office.

Works in discovering the information hidden in vast amounts of data to help in presenting data to present to leadership allowing them to make smarter decisions to deliver even better performance of our THCE program. The primary focus is applying data mining techniques, doing advanced analysis, and building high quality ad hoc systems integrated with our operations. Automates scoring techniques to assist in department improvements, builds recommendation systems, improves and extends the features used by our existing applications, develops internal A/B testing procedures, builds system data integration between multiple applications, develops applications and reports to assist leadership in decision making process, create and automates reporting and processes to assist THCE team with performance.


Works closely with Trinity Information Services to ensure the CMMS Application servers are maintained and kept current. Provides first level support for any downtime occurrences. Leads processing of all patches and updates to the applications. Creates topic specific ad hoc applications within SQL and HTML to meet the needs of the operations, i.e. HTML Splash Page, automatic notifications, THCE Finance Application for budget building and Intercompany Transfer documentation, interfaces to/from (PeopleSoft, etc.). Responsible for learning and supporting the new cloud based Facilio (CMMS) to support adding fields and reports as the THCE Dept grows in operational performance.

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S

Knows, understands, incorporates and demonstrates the Trinity Health Mission, Vision, and Values in behaviors, practices and decisions.

Maintains a working knowledge of applicable Federal, State, and local laws and regulations, Trinity Health Corporate Integrity Program, Code of Ethics, as well as other policies and procedures in order to ensure adherence in a manner that reflects honest, ethical, and professional behavior.

Develops solutions to support relationship with System Office finance, purchasing and TIS to improve data mining and analytics to support THCE operations through the CMMS. Serves as data expert with all aspects of the CMMS including data structures and tables, and leads development of new end user tools.

Supports Business Application team in ensuring that the CMMS is in compliance with local, state and federal regulations, as well as with JCAHO EC, AOA, CAP, and ANSI/AAMI EQ standards.

Directly responsible for the management and administration of the CMMS Web Based work order entry and review component, as well as, any supporting hardware peripherals deployed to support the use of applications/systems, i.e. scanners/readers etc..

Directly responsible for CMMS troubleshooting, resolution, and coordinating/performing upgrades with Trinity Information System.

Directly responsible for analyzing, and maintaining standardized data tables.

Develops database-stored procedures to support operations and analytics.

Pro-actively analyzes, monitors, and creates reports to identify cost reduction, resource productivity, and service agreement expiration and compliance

improvement, through tools such as, Excel, Power BI, Tableau, etc.

Provides other database support to staff as needed, and completes all other tasks as assigned.

Possesses a personal presence that is characterized by a sense of honesty, integrity, and caring with the ability to inspire and motivate others to promote the philosophy, mission, vision, goals, and values of Trinity Health.

Maintains HIPPA compliance and confidentially of information received, pertaining to but not limited patient, physicians, and associates.

MINIMUM QUALIFICATIONS

A minimum of a Bachelor's degree in business administration or information technology, or equivalent combination of education and experience; and five (5) years of progressively more responsible experience in data analytics or informatics. MBA and/or advanced degree is preferred. Experience in supply chain, finance/accounting, inventory control, production or purchasing is strongly preferred.

Must possess an in-depth knowledge of the system development lifecycle and an ability to develop appropriate methodologies for collecting, analyzing and evaluating large amounts of data.

Strong working knowledge of SQL, HTML, ServiceNow and database schema's. Proficient in the use of Excel, Power BI, Tableau, Visio, Access, MS Project and PowerPoint is required.

Strong working knowledge of Computers including operating systems, advanced understanding of Wireless and Network Communications, and Web Based Application Development languages, i.e. html, java.

Must be comfortable with conflict and willing to challenge conventional thinking at all levels of the organization.

Must possess strong analytical skills, including ability to understand and define most critical issues and develop methodologies for collecting and analyzing relevant data (keep vs. buy, Total Cost Ownership (TCO), lease vs. buy, Net Present Value (NPV), Cost of Service Ratio (COSR), and so forth).

Must possess strong written and verbal communication skills in order to effectively discuss data analytics with diverse groups and prepare reports.

Must possess excellent organizational and planning skills.

Must be a self-starter with ability to juggle priorities and manage own work to completion.

Strong organizational and planning skills to support involvement in multiple projects simultaneously in an environment of competing priorities.

Must possess ability to be comfortable operating in a collaborative, shared leadership environment.

Supports and executes strategies related to improving the reporting and analytic capabilities through facilitating detailed requirements gathering, report/dashboard testing, training and maintenance. Provides reporting support from SCIS (Supply Chain Information System) and other available systems such as DSS, SSID and 3rd party tools. Supports on boarding of merger and acquisition targets to the SCIS data environment.

Meticulous in attention to detail.
